HVAC thermostat repair services involve diagnosing and fixing issues with the device that controls a building’s heating and cooling systems. Thermostats are essential for maintaining a comfortable indoor environment by regulating temperature settings. When a thermostat malfunctions, it can cause the HVAC system to operate improperly, leading to inconsistent temperatures, increased energy bills, or system failures. Local contractors specializing in thermostat repair can assess the device, identify the root cause of the problem, and perform the necessary repairs to restore proper operation, ensuring the heating and cooling systems work efficiently and reliably.

Many common problems can signal the need for thermostat repair. These include the thermostat not turning on, displaying inaccurate temperature readings, or failing to respond to adjustments. Sometimes, the device may be unresponsive, or the HVAC system might cycle on and off unexpectedly. These issues can stem from faulty wiring, dead batteries, calibration errors, or worn-out components within the thermostat. Addressing these problems promptly with professional repair services can prevent further system damage, improve energy efficiency, and maintain a comfortable indoor climate.

The overview below groups typical Hvac Thermostat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Basic thermostat repairs typically range from $150 to $300. Many routine fixes fall within this band, covering common issues like sensor calibration or minor component replacements.

Thermostat Replacement - Replacing an outdated or malfunctioning thermostat usually costs between $250 and $600. Most projects in this range involve standard models and straightforward installations.

Full System Tune-Ups - Comprehensive HVAC thermostat system tune-ups generally fall between $300 and $800. Larger, more complex projects can reach $1,200 or more, especially for systems integrated with smart technology.

Complete System Replacement - Replacing an entire HVAC control system can cost from $2,500 up to $5,000 or higher. Fewer projects reach the highest tiers, with many falling into the mid-range for standard setups.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s that a thermostat needs repair? Signs include inconsistent temperature control, the thermostat not turning on, or digital display issues. If these problems occur, local service providers can assess and repair the thermostat as needed.

Can a thermostat be repaired instead of replaced? Yes, many thermostat issues can be fixed through repairs, such as recalibration or replacing faulty components. Local contractors can determine if repair is a viable option.

What types of thermostats can local service providers repair? They can typically repair various types, including digital, programmable, and smart thermostats, depending on the specific model and issue.

Is it necessary to hire a professional for thermostat repairs? While some minor issues might be DIY fixable, most repairs benefit from the expertise of local contractors to ensure proper functioning and safety.

What should be prepared before a thermostat repair appointment? It's helpful to have information about the thermostat model, any recent issues experienced, and access to the unit for the service provider to inspect and diagnose effectively.
